Further Information A Northern Ballet (UK) production based on the novel by Charles Dickens. This is the first time this work, created for the Northern Ballet about 20 years ago, has been seen outside the UK. Uses Northern ballet's sets and costumes. Daniel de Andrade has come to teach it to the RNZB. St James Theatre Wellington 30 October - 8 November; Regent Theatre Dunedin 15-16 November; Isaac Theatre Royal Christchurch 20 - 22 November; Regent on Broadway Palmerston North 26 November; Napier Municipal Theatre 29 -30 November; ASB Theatre, Aotea Centre Auckland 3 - 7 December; Bruce Mason Centre Takapuna 13 - 14 December.
